Meanwhile, Gansa is he's excited for the return of science fiction drama The X-Files.
Gansa was a key writer during the early seasons of the original The X-Files series.
"I cannot wait. Mulder and Scully are like part of my family, so I'm really, really curious to see what the show is going to look like," Gansa told Fox.
"It's going to be very exciting and interesting."
Unfortunately, however, Gansa said he won't be involved in the series limited return.
"I am so sorry that I was too busy to be involved," he said.
